Rabu, 17 Juni 2015

Komputasi dan parallel processing

KOMPUTASI

       Komputasi merupakan cara untuk menemukan pemecahan masalah dari data input dengan menggunakan suatu algoritma. Kemudian teori komputasi adalah suatu sub-bidang dari ilmu komputer dan matematika. Selama ribuan tahun, perhitungan dan komputasi umumnya dilakukan dengan menggunakan pena dan kertas atau kapur dan batu tulis, atau dikerjakan secara mental, kadang-kadang dengan bantuan suatu tabel. Pada zaman sekarang ini, komputasi dilakukan dengan cara menggunakan komputer. Komputasi yang menggunakan komputer inilah maka disebut dengan Komputasi Modern.

perhitungan komputasi modern yaitu seperti :
Akurasi (bit, floating point)
Kecepatan (dalam satuanHz)
Problem volume besar (paralel)
Modeling (NN dan GA)

Kompleksitas (menggunakan Teori Bog O)



PARALLEL PROCESSING

            Penggunaan lebih dari satu CPU atau inti prosesor secara simultan untuk mengeksekusi sebuah program atau banyak program dengan komputasi ganda. Idealnya, parallel processing membuat program berjalan lebih cepat karena ada mesin yang lebih (CPU atau core) menjalankannya.
                       Dalam praktek pararel processing, seringkali sulit membagi program sedemikian rupa sehingga terpisah atau CPU core dapat mengeksekusi bagian yang berbeda tanpa mengganggu satu sama lain. Sebagian besar komputer hanya memiliki satu CPU, tetapi beberapa model memiliki beberapa chip prosesor, dan multi-core menjadi norma. Bahkan ada komputer dengan ribuan CPU.



KOMPUTASI PARALEL


               Salah satu teknik untuk melakukan komputasi secara bersamaan dengan memanfaatkan beberapa komputer secara bersamaan. Biasanya diperlukan saat kapasitas yang diperlukan sangat besar, baik karena harus mengolah data dalam jumlah besar ataupun karena tuntutan proses komputasi yang banyak. 
               Untuk melakukan aneka jenis komputasi paralel ini diperlukan infrastruktur mesin paralel yang terdiri dari banyak komputer yang dihubungkan dengan jaringan dan mampu bekerja secara paralel untuk menyelesaikan satu masalah. Untuk itu diperlukan aneka perangkat lunak pendukung yang biasa disebut sebagai middleware yang berperan untuk mengatur distribusi pekerjaan antar node dalam satu mesin paralel. Selanjutnya pemakai harus membuat pemrograman paralel untuk merealisasikan komputasi.


HUBUNGAN KOMPUTASI DAN PARALLEL PROCESSING

                   Parallel processing merupakan salah satu teknik dari komputasi modern, merupakan  teknik terdistribusi yang canggih untuk melaksanakan tugas yang banyak secara bersamaan, sehingga proses komputasi yang dilakukan dapat lebih cepat.

Kelebihan :
Mempercepat waktu eksekusi
Mempercepat pengiriman data

Kelemahan :
Membutuhkan daya yang besar
Biaya perangkat keras lebih banyak.

Untuk Referensi Artikel Pilih :

0 komentar:

Posting Komentar